Susquehannock edges West York in title rematch


Anthony DeVincent, Adam Rebich and Dorian Faster scored two goals apiece to help the Susquehannock boys' lacrosse team hold off West York, 7-6, on Thursday in a rematch of last year's YAIAA tournament championship game.

The Warriors pulled to a 4-1 lead after the first quarter before the Bulldogs erased the three-goal deficit to tie the score at 4-4 in the third quarter. But Faster and Rebich scored three straight goals to push Susquehannock back in front.

Susquehannock won despite being charged with more than 15 minutes of penalty time.
